The key Houses of a stem cell ended up first described by Ernest McCulloch and James Until on the College of Toronto and also the Ontario Most cancers Institute during the early nineteen sixties. They identified the blood-forming stem cell, the hematopoietic stem cell (HSC), by their revolutionary work in mice. McCulloch and Till commenced a series of experiments by which bone marrow cells have been injected into irradiated mice. They observed lumps within the spleens in the mice that were linearly proportional to the amount of bone marrow cells injected.

50 Cord blood derived CD34+ cells have quite strong hematopoietic skills, which is attributed into the immaturity from the stem cells relative to Grownup derived cells. Studies are already finished that assess long run survival of youngsters with hematologic Conditions who had been transplanted with umbilical cord blood from the sibling donor. These studied unveiled exactly the same or much better survival in the kids that obtained the umbilical twine blood relative to people who bought transplantation from bone marrow cells. In addition, premiums of relapse ended up the identical for equally umbilical cord blood and bone marrow transplant.51

Concerning the oscillatory exercise from the segmentation clock, Yamanaka and colleagues observed a definite loss of HES7 oscillation. In axioloids derived from iPS cell strains launched with a degree mutation in HES7, there were also losses of rostro-caudal patterning, but these versions managed to precise standard HES7 oscillation during the tail bud as well as a few somitic mesoderm markers. MESP2 is known being mutated in people with SDV. Yamanaka and colleagues also assessed the results of axioloids with MESP2 knockout. MESP2-knockout axioloids also lacked segments and epithelial somites and exhibited irregular rostro-caudal patterning, Regardless of their regular elongation. On the other hand, MESP2 knockout did not bring about the lack of oscillation of stem cell treatment HES7. Therefore, these axioloids function designs that offer insights to the segmentation enhancement from the human human body and also a System to study the pathogenesis of the spine.
